The Medtronic Marksman Micro Catheter (REF FA-55150-1030) is a single-lumen, variable-stiffness neurovascular microcatheter engineered to support navigation through tortuous distal cerebral anatomy and to facilitate the controlled delivery of compatible interventional devices and diagnostic agents. With a 0.027 in inner diameter and a 150 cm working length, this configuration is intended to support reach to distal cerebrovascular targets while maintaining lumen compatibility with a range of neurovascular implants.
Key Features
- Inner diameter: 0.027 in, sized to support compatible neurovascular device delivery
- Working length: 150 cm for distal intracranial access
- Variable-stiffness shaft transitioning from a supportive proximal segment to a flexible distal segment
- Hydrophilic coating on the distal portion intended to reduce surface friction during navigation
- Radiopaque distal marker(s) to aid fluoroscopic visualization
- Single-lumen construction designed for guidewire tracking and device delivery
- Luer hub for standard accessory and infusion line connection
Clinical Applications
- Navigation of guidewires and compatible interventional devices within the neurovasculature
- Delivery of compatible neurovascular implants sized to a 0.027 in inner lumen
- Selective infusion of physician-specified diagnostic or therapeutic agents into the cerebral vasculature
- Support of distal access in tortuous intracranial anatomy during neurointerventional procedures
